1. The Sand Museum in Tottori, Japan

The Feeling You’ll Find Here: Ephemeral Grandeur

Nestled beside the sweeping ripples of the Tottori Sand Dunes in Tottori, Japan, the Sand Museum celebrates the beauty of transience. While the museum first launched its groundbreaking concepts in 2006, it established the world’s first permanent indoor sand art facility in 2012, allowing master sculptors from across the globe to gather annually.

Using only sand and water, these artists spend a rigorous two weeks hand-crafting massive, highly detailed tableaus centred around a changing annual theme—ranging from the grandeur of the Italian Renaissance to African safaris. While the creation process is brief, the breathtaking results are preserved for an eight-to-nine-month exhibition season (typically from mid-April to early January) before being returned to the earth, ensuring that no two visits to this museum will ever be the same.

2. The Mummies of Guanajuato, Mexico

The Feeling You’ll Find Here: A Cultural Reverence for the Afterlife

In Mexico, death is not viewed as an end, but as a vibrant continuation of life—a philosophy famously embodied by the annual Día de los Muertos celebrations. For a deeper, deeply historic look into this cultural perspective, the Mummy Museum in the UNESCO World Heritage city of Guanajuato is unmatched.

The museum serves as the resting place for 119 naturally mummified bodies, preserved by the region’s unique soil composition and dry climate. Displayed with profound historical context, the collection features residents from the 19th and 20th centuries. It stands as a powerful, hauntingly beautiful testament to the region’s ancestral past and its distinct relationship with mortality.

3. The Damara Living Museum near Twyfelfontein, Namibia

The Feeling You’ll Find Here:  Awe for the Living History and Cultural Preservation

A Sustainable Impact Pick: Visiting the Damara Living Museum directly supports the local community, providing vital economic independence while ensuring that ancient indigenous heritage is actively preserved for future generations.

Lost in the rugged, sun-drenched landscapes near the ancient rock engravings of Twyfelfontein, the Damara Living Museum offers a complete departure from the traditional gallery setting. The Damara are among the oldest indigenous communities in Namibia, and this open-air, community-led initiative allows travelers to experience their traditional way of life firsthand.

This is a dynamic, hands-on encounter. Discerning travelers can engage directly with community members, observing traditional blacksmithing, the crafting of intricate beadwork, and the gathering of herbal medicines. The experience culminates in the village center, where the complex, rhythmic clicks of the Khoisan language come alive through captivating traditional songs and dances.

4. The Zeitz MOCAA in Cape Town, South Africa

The Feeling You’ll Find Here: Delight in Architectural Marvel Meets Contemporary Vision

Replacing traditional hotel art walks with world-class institutional curation, the Zeitz Museum of Contemporary Art Africa (MOCAA) is a must-visit architectural triumph anchoring Cape Town’s V&A Waterfront.

Masterfully carved out of a historic, 1920s grain silo complex by designer Thomas Heatherwick, the building’s atrium is shaped like a single grain of corn scaled up to monumental proportions. Inside, this multi-story marvel houses the world’s largest museum dedicated exclusively to contemporary art from Africa and its diaspora. It represents the pinnacle of modern African cultural expression, making it an essential stop on any luxury South African holiday.

5. The Museo Subacuatico de Arte / MUSA in Cancun, Mexico

The Feeling You’ll Find Here:  A Submerged Wonder of Eco-Conscious Art

For those who prefer their cultural excursions with a dash of adventure, MUSA offers a spectacular submerged gallery in the waters of the Cancún National Marine Park. Conceived by British sculptor Jason deCaires Taylor and brought to life alongside visionary Mexican artists, this underwater museum features over 500 life-sized sculptures resting on the ocean floor.

Beyond its surreal visual appeal—featuring haunting human figures and a replica of a classic VW Beetle—MUSA is a triumph of marine conservation. Every sculpture is cast from specialized pH-neutral marine concrete, specifically designed to encourage coral growth. Over time, the ocean transforms the art into thriving artificial reefs, diverting tourists away from fragile natural formations and fostering local biodiversity. Discerning guests can explore this silent world via private diving excursions, snorkeling, or from the comfort of a luxury glass-bottom boat.
